版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、基于Matlab的數(shù)字濾波器設(shè)計 基于Matlab的數(shù)字濾波器設(shè)計1.數(shù)字濾波器概述 1.1數(shù)字濾波器的分類 1.2 數(shù)字濾波器的表示方法 2.數(shù)字濾波器的優(yōu)點3 Matlab中的數(shù)字濾波器設(shè)計 3.1軟件實現(xiàn)方式 3.2硬件實現(xiàn)方式 1數(shù)字濾波器概述 數(shù)字濾波器不用物理元器件構(gòu)成,而是按照某種算法編寫一段程序或模塊,對數(shù)字信號進行處理加工,從而達到濾波的要求。數(shù)字濾波器是實現(xiàn)濾波過程的一種數(shù)字信號處理系統(tǒng),具有離散時間系統(tǒng)的基本特征。 1.1數(shù)字濾波器的分類按結(jié)構(gòu)特點分 按沖擊響應(yīng)分 按頻率特性分 數(shù)字濾波器 按頻率特性分數(shù)字濾波器 低通濾波器高通濾波器帶通濾波器帶阻濾波器 按沖擊響應(yīng)分數(shù)字
2、濾波器無限長沖擊響應(yīng)濾波器(IIR):對單位沖激的輸入信號的響應(yīng)為無限長序列 有限長沖擊響應(yīng)濾波器(FIR):對單位沖激的輸入信號的響應(yīng)為有限長序列 按結(jié)構(gòu)特點分數(shù)字濾波器數(shù)字濾波器 遞歸型濾波器 非遞歸型濾波器 無限長沖擊響應(yīng)濾波器 有限長沖擊響應(yīng)濾波器1.2 數(shù)字濾波器的表示方法 1.差分方式表示 其中輸入信號為x(t),輸出信號為y(t) ,ai,bi為常數(shù)2.傳遞函數(shù)表示 在差分方程的基礎(chǔ)上,方程取Z變換,化簡可得3.單位響應(yīng)沖擊響應(yīng)輸入單位沖擊時間序列的濾波器輸出序列任意輸入信號時的數(shù)字濾波器輸出4.頻率特性表示頻率特性是數(shù)字濾波器對正弦輸入序列的響應(yīng) 其中,H(jwTs)和頻率f構(gòu)
3、成幅頻特性,(w)和頻率f構(gòu)成相頻特性。2 數(shù)字濾波器的優(yōu)點 性能穩(wěn)定 高度的靈活性 無阻抗匹配問題 方便的做到分時復(fù)用 3 Matlab中的數(shù)字濾波器設(shè)計 有兩種方法: 1基于濾波程序和算法的軟件實現(xiàn)方式。 2基于數(shù)字部件模塊的硬件實現(xiàn)方式。 適用于知道需要濾除的諧波的次數(shù)適用于硬件搭建模型 軟件實現(xiàn)方式以簡單的減法濾波器作為介紹: 減法濾波器差分方程為 其幅頻特性方程為 根據(jù)想消除的諧波次數(shù),來確定參數(shù)的值??梢愿鶕?jù)下式確定 式中,為1,2,3。這種方法雖然可以達到濾波效果,但是需要人為計算,在編寫濾波程序之前,需要知道濾波器的差分方程,較為麻煩。例 假設(shè)一個系統(tǒng)的采樣頻率為1200Hz,
4、要濾除直流分量和4,8,12次諧波 。 分析:由于奈奎斯特采樣定理的限制,最多只能消除12次諧波 ,當采用減法濾波器時,經(jīng)過計算所需差分方程為 在Matlab的M腳本下編寫濾波函數(shù),繪出幅頻特性。 %設(shè)置減法濾波器的傳遞函數(shù)系數(shù)a1=1,b1=1 0 0 0 0 0 -1;f=0:1:600;h1=abs(freqz(b1,a1,f,1200);%由傳遞函數(shù)系數(shù)確定傳遞函數(shù)的幅頻特性H1=h1/max(h1);%繪出幅頻特性plot(f,H1);xlabel(f/Hz);ylabel(H1);幅頻特性疊加直流分量和4、8次諧波 ,然后濾波N=24;t1=(0:0.02/N:0.04);m=si
5、ze(t1);%基波電壓va=100*sin(2*pi*50*t1);%疊加直流分量和4,8次諧波分量va1=35+100*sin(2*pi*50*t1)+30*sin(4*pi*100*t1)+10*sin(8*pi*100*t1);%采用減法濾波器濾掉va1中的直流分量和4,8次諧波分量Y=zeros(1,6);for jj=7:m(2) Y(jj)=(va1(jj)-va1(jj-6)/1.414;end%輸出波形, 每周期采樣24個點,一個點相當于15度,6個點為90度,移項90度的波形和原始波形疊加后波形幅值會增大倍,為了便于比較,疊加后的波形幅值除以。plot(t1,va,-ro,
6、t1,va1,-bs,t1,Y,-g*);xlabel(t/s);ylabel(v/v);grid on硬件實現(xiàn)方式 在Matlab中,有現(xiàn)成的濾波器模塊,使用時只需設(shè)置相應(yīng)參數(shù),使用方便。在Matlab中Simulink命令下Single Processing BlocksetFilteringFilter Designs目錄下有Digital Filter Design模塊可以設(shè)計用戶所需要的數(shù)字濾波器。 參數(shù)設(shè)計區(qū)特性區(qū)濾波器轉(zhuǎn)換(TransForm Filter) 實現(xiàn)模型(Realize Model) 零極點編輯器(Pole-zero Editor) 導(dǎo)入濾波器(Import Fil
7、ter) 設(shè)計濾波器(Design Filter) Response type(濾波器類型)選項,包括lowpass(低通)、highpass(高通)、bandpass(帶通)、bandstop(帶阻)和特殊的FIR濾波器 Design method(設(shè)計方法)選項,包括IIR濾波器的butterworth(巴特沃思)法、chebyshev type i(切比雪夫i型)法、 chebyshev type ii(切比雪夫ii型)法、elliptic(橢圓濾波器)法和FIR濾波器的equiripple法、least-squares(最小乘方)法、window(窗函數(shù))法 Filter order(
8、濾波器階數(shù))選項,定義濾波器的階數(shù),包括specify order(指定階數(shù))和minimum order(最小階數(shù))。在specify order中填入所要設(shè)計的濾波器的階數(shù)(n階濾波器,specify ordern-1),如果選擇minimum order則matlab根據(jù)所選擇的濾波器類型自動使用最小階數(shù)。 Frenquency specifications選項,可以詳細定義頻帶的各參數(shù),包括采樣頻率fs和頻帶的截止頻率。它的具體選項由filter type選項和design method選項決定,bandpass(帶通)濾波器需要定義fstop1(下阻帶截止頻率)、fpass1(通帶下
9、限截止頻率)、fpass2(通帶上限截止頻率)、fstop2(上阻帶截止頻率),而lowpass(低通)濾波器只需要定義fstop1、fpass1。采用窗函數(shù)設(shè)計濾波器時,由于過渡帶是由窗函數(shù)的類型和階數(shù)所決定的,所以只需要定義通帶截止頻率,而不必定義阻帶參數(shù)。Magnitude specifications選項,可以定義幅值衰減的情況。例如設(shè)計帶通濾波器時,可以定義wstop1(頻率fstop1處的幅值衰減)、wpass(通帶范圍內(nèi)的幅值衰減)、wstop2(頻率fstop2處的幅值衰減)。當采用窗函數(shù)設(shè)計時,通帶截止頻率處的幅值衰減固定為6db,所以不必定義。 為了更好的說明各種設(shè)計方法之間的差別,采用控制變量的方法,在其他條件不變的前提下,分別采用窗函數(shù)法(凱澤窗、漢寧窗、漢明窗、布萊克窗窗)、波紋逼近法、最小乘方法對FIR數(shù)字低通濾波器進行設(shè)計并比較,最終得出結(jié)論,說明各種設(shè)計方法的適用情況。 97階凱澤窗97階漢明窗97階漢寧窗97階布萊克窗波紋逼近法最小乘方法結(jié)論 在同樣濾波器階數(shù)情況下,窗函數(shù)設(shè)計法設(shè)計方法相對簡便,通帶內(nèi)穩(wěn)定性高,過渡帶寬度隨窗函數(shù)種類變化,其中漢寧窗、漢明窗、布萊克曼窗函數(shù)法的過渡帶相比凱澤窗較窄,但凱澤窗最小阻帶衰減最高;波紋逼近法設(shè)計出的濾波器相對其他幾種方法通帶內(nèi)不夠平穩(wěn);最小乘方法相比于其他設(shè)計方法誤差較低,通帶內(nèi)平穩(wěn)
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 新房安裝玻璃合同模板
- 常用外貿(mào)合同模板
- 商標加工服務(wù)合同范例
- 關(guān)于電器合同范例
- 個人清工合同范例
- 產(chǎn)品代理合同范例
- 收益保障合同模板
- 承包旅館合同范例
- 巖土設(shè)計合同范例
- 施工圍墻廣告合同范例
- 2024年醫(yī)院內(nèi)窺鏡室護理工作計劃
- 建材行業(yè)安全生產(chǎn)培訓
- 高效的跨部門協(xié)作與溝通
- 基于PLC飲用水源初處理控制系統(tǒng)設(shè)計
- 制造業(yè)升級2024年的智能制造計劃
- 大學食品安全案例
- 《商不變的規(guī)律》教學課件
- 單位工程施工組織設(shè)計實例樣本
- 制作西式面點培訓課件教案
- 敬畏課堂 發(fā)言稿 國旗下的講話
- 平面設(shè)計工作室計劃書
評論
0/150
提交評論